Search for new GSPCB Chairperson, Member Secretary begins

Three-year-long term of the Chairman Ganesh Shetgaonkar is coming to an end

Panjim: As the three-year-long term of the incumbent chairman of the Goa State Pollution Control Board (GSPCB) Ganesh Shetgaonkar comes to an end, the State government has initiated the process to appoint a new Chairperson and Member Secretary (MS) of the Pollution Board. 

The Directorate of Environment has invited applications for the post of Chairperson and MS, for which knowledge of environmental sciences and environmental management has been made mandatory. The candidate has to also be a resident of Goa for at least 15 years, and the knowledge of Konkani is mandatory while that of Marathi is desirable. The last date of application is October 29. 

Following the directions received  from the Supreme Court and National Green Tribunal (NGT) , the State government had then framed the appointment rules and guidelines for the two posts, earlier this year. 

According to new guidelines, there would be 19 members’ board instead of 16 members that includes Chairperson, MS and seventeen members to be nominated by the State government to represent interest of agriculture, fishery or industry or trade and local authorities functioning within the State.

The age limit of the applicant should not exceed 60 years. The recruitment would be done by the Selection Committee on contract or deputation basis.
